SunnyBeBe October 26, 2021 Share October 26, 2021 Another thing about puppies that will grow into large dogs, as those above. (They appear to be labs. And they like lots of activity.). They are gregarious dogs, imo. Friendly, but without training will jump up on you, mouth with their teeth, and smother you with affection, which can be heavy against young kids. My young nieces loved their puppy, until he started playing rough, scratching their skin, knocking them down, etc. A small breed would have worked much better for them. They had to re-home their dog when he got too large and the girls didn’t want him near them due to how unruly he was. Not his fault at all. There was a serious lack of planning with getting toddlers and pre-schoolers large breed dogs, when you are not prepared to do some daily exercise and training with the dogs. Link to comment
